Diamond grading and certification payments to non-resident laboratories are analysed as consideration for independent examination and reporting of a diamond's physical characteristics, rather than managerial, technical or consultancy services. The use of specialised personnel or equipment does not alone convert such payments into fees for technical services. Under the India-USA and India-UK treaty provisions on fees for included services, a grading report does not "make available" technical knowledge, skill, know-how or a process because it does not enable the recipient to conduct future grading independently. In the absence of a permanent establishment, the payments are discussed as business profits not chargeable to tax in India, with no related withholding obligation.
